Enhancing the human experience starts with putting peoplefirst.

In this episode of Powered by Authenticity, Emily sits downwith Chris Hallberg, CEO of GoExpand, and founder of The Business Sergeant. Chris is a veteran, entrepreneur, and leadership coach who believes organizations perform best when leaders empower others to lead.

Together, they explore leadership that scales, teams thatexecute, and why the strongest organizations are built on trust, accountability, and clear ownership.

Drawing from military experience and years of coachingleadership teams through EOS, Chris shares practical lessons on empowering middle managers, defining roles, and creating businesses that grow beyond the founder.

The conversation also turns to a challenge that extends farbeyond the workplace. Every day, an estimated 22 veterans lose their lives to suicide. Chris shares why creating opportunities, building community, and removing the stigma around asking for help remain central to the mission of TheBusiness Sergeant and the work still ahead of us.

About Chris:

Chris Hallberg is a military veteran, entrepreneur,leadership coach, and founder of GoExpand. Known as The Business Sergeant, he helps organizations turn execution challenges into competitive advantages through practical leadership, accountability, and business operating systems.

After serving in the military, Chris built and successfullyexited multiple companies, including an energy-efficiency business that was sold during the Great Recession. He later became one of the earliest EOS Implementers, Coaching more than 100 leadership teams through multi-year growthjourneys and helping organizations improve execution, culture, and employee engagement.

Chris is also the founder of Business Sergeant, a leadershipplatform and veteran community dedicated to helping military veterans transition into civilian leadership roles while connecting businesses with exceptional leadership talent. Recognized by Inc. Magazine as a Top 10 Global Leadership & Management Expert, Chris is known for translatingmilitary leadership principles into practical strategies that help entrepreneurs and leadership teams build stronger, more disciplined organizations.
